how bad can carpal tunnel get?

i have had cts for years ever since i got pregnant. but mine never went away. now ever morning when i wake up my right hand is numb and i cant do anything. it takes about 5 to 10 mins to get the feelings back. my husband has tried to get me to have it checked out,but if this is as bad as it gets i can live with it. ive had too many surgeries to even consider that,and ive tried splints and it never worked. is this as bad as it gets?or do i have to look foward to it getting alot worse? thanks for any input

Re: how bad can carpal tunnel get?

Hi Nikjosh

I'll reply to your post! Hate to tell you but it can & does get a lot worse in some cases. If the nerve has pressure on it for too long then it can literally die off so you end up with fingers with no feeling in them. The muscles can wither too. The ones below my thumbs are pretty wasted & I had surgery within a year of diagnosis.

I think maybe the best thing you can do is to get some nerve conduction studies done. Those will give you a better indication of how bad the situation is & whether or not you really need surgery. You might be in a position to put up with it meantime like I am with ulnar nerve problems.

Listen to your husband - he's right!

Cool Re: how bad can carpal tunnel get?

The nerves which serve our fingers, start off in the neck, so yes, the pain can travel or be caused by a problem in the neck e.g. some type of injury. Those Nerve studies can tell exactly where the entrapment is along the line. It's a bit like checking the wiring on an electrical appliance
